ORDER OF BUSINESS
Mr. SCHUMER. Mr. President, I ask unanimous consent that the Senate
resume legislative session and proceed to the consideration of H.R.
9468, which was received from the House and is at the desk; further,
that the only amendment in order to the bill be the Paul amendment No.
3289, which is at the desk; that the time until 11:30 a.m. be for
debate only on the amendment and that at 11:30 a.m. the Senate vote on
the amendment, with 60 affirmative votes required for adoption;
further, that upon disposition of the amendment, the bill, as amended,
if amended, be considered read a third time and the Senate vote on
passage of the bill, as amended, if amended, all without further
intervening action or debate.
The ACTING PRESIDENT pro tempore. Without objection, it is so
ordered.
